Hello! We are GoFasti, a Talent-as-a-Service. GoFasti bridges the gap between world-class developers and designers from LatAm and first-class companies around the globe.

We need an English-fluent Project Manager, based in Latin America, available to work remotely.
We are looking for someone with exceptional communication and relationship-building skills, who embraces changes while maintaining strong attention to detail. An interested and proactive person, who's constantly learning and improving their skills.

Are you the one we are looking for?

Responsibilities:

  • Familiarity with Project Management (Predictive, Hybrid) and Agile methodologies (Scrum, Kanban, Lean) best practices.
  • Facilitate team workshops and Agile ceremonies, such as User Story Mapping, daily stand-ups, sprint planning, and retrospectives.
  • Proactively identify risks and remove obstacles that may hinder the team's progress.
  • Collaborate with internal Product and Engineering team members only.
  • Planning, organizing, and coordinating Agile projects from initiation to completion

Requirements:

  • 3+ years of experience as a project manager.
  • Ability to plan, organize, and track projects from start to finish.
  • Experience managing projects across the Product Development Lifecycle (PDLC).
  • Working knowledge of project management approaches (Predictive/Waterfall, and Hybrid).
  • Experience using Agile methodologies such as Scrum, Kanban, and Lean.
  • Ability to run Agile ceremonies, including daily stand-ups, sprint planning, and retrospectives.
  • Experience facilitating workshops like user story mapping.
  • Ability to plan, organize, and track projects from start to finish.
  • Proven ability to identify risks and remove blockers that impact team progress.
  • Clear and effective communication and coordination skills.

Compensation:

  • The Salary range offered for this position varies from (USD) $2,000 - $2,500 per month, depending on seniority and skillset.
  • This position is for an independent contractor, through a payroll platform.
  • The talent will work REMOTELY allocated at our client.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
